The Department of Veterans Affairs is seeking a highly skilled Clinical Pharmacy Specialist to join our team. As a Clinical Pharmacy Specialist, you will play a critical role in providing exceptional patient care and contributing to the development of our pharmacy services.
Key Responsibilities- Provide direct and indirect patient care, including medication therapy monitoring, formulary management, and staff education.
- Collaborate with healthcare providers to optimize medication use and improve patient health outcomes.
- Develop and implement pharmaceutical care plans, including documentation in electronic health records.
- Order and review laboratory tests and diagnostic studies to support patient care.
- Participate in medication reconciliation and evaluate appropriateness of medications during transitions of care.
- Monitor and report drug errors, adverse drug reactions, allergies, and patient compliance issues.
- Support effective drug usage criteria and ensure appropriate utilization of the VHA formulary.
- Collaborate with physicians and other healthcare professionals in the design and implementation of drug research protocols.
- Provide in-service education programs to develop pharmacy staff and educate other healthcare disciplines.
- Evaluate physician orders for appropriateness based on patient medication profiles and input information into computer systems.
- Graduate of an Accreditation Council for Pharmacy Education (ACPE) accredited College or School of Pharmacy with a baccalaureate degree in pharmacy (BS Pharmacy) and/or a Doctor of Pharmacy (Pharm.D.) degree.
- Full, current, and unrestricted license to practice pharmacy in a State, Territory, Commonwealth of the United States (i.e., Puerto Rico), or the District of Columbia.
- English language proficiency.
- At least 1 year of experience equivalent to the next lower grade level.
- Completion of a Pharmacy Practice or Specialty Residency with a substantial component (>50%) of patient care activities in pharmacotherapy.
- Three (3) years of practice experience with a substantial component (>50%) of patient care activities in pharmacotherapy.
This position requires standing (4 hours), walking (4 hours), repeated bending (4 hours), twisting, and carrying/lifting moderately heavy items (lbs). A driver's license and physical exam are required to confirm ability to operate a government vehicle.
